World Cup Wagers: Day 1

It turns out that I did not win the billion-dollar…

World Cup Group E preview

Just eight days until the World Cup kicks off! We’re…

Best XI: Euro 2020 group stage matches

The Euro 2020 group stages concluded yesterday. 72 matches occupied…